Job Details The Electrician Foreman is responsible for leading and
supervising electrical field crews on MEP construction projects.
This position ensures all electrical installations are completed
safely, efficiently, and in coordination with mechanical and
plumbing systems. The Foreman serves as a hands-on leader,
maintaining high-quality workmanship, adherence to project
schedules, and compliance with all applicable codes and company
standards. Essential Duties and Responsibilities: Supervise and
coordinate daily activities of electricians and apprentices on
commercial and industrial MEP projects. Review and interpret
electrical drawings, schematics, and specifications to plan work
sequences and verify alignment with mechanical and plumbing
systems. Schedule and assign tasks to crews, ensuring productivity
and quality expectations are met. Collaborate closely with
mechanical and plumbing foremen to prevent trade conflicts and
ensure smooth installation sequences. Inspect completed work for
compliance with the National Electrical Code (NEC), local codes,
and company quality standards. Ensure all work is performed safely
in accordance with company safety policies, OSHA regulations, and
site-specific requirements. Train and mentor apprentices and
journeymen, promoting professional growth and trade skill
development. Communicate daily with the Electrical Superintendent
and Project Manager regarding progress, issues, manpower needs, and
material requirements. Maintain accurate daily reports, timesheets,
and jobsite documentation. Perform troubleshooting, testing, and
system commissioning as required. Manage jobsite tools, materials,
and equipment to minimize waste and maintain organization.
Qualifications: High school diploma or equivalent required;
completion of an accredited electrical apprenticeship preferred.
Current state Journeyman or Master Electrician License required.
Minimum 5 years of electrical field experience, including at least
2 years in a supervisory role. Strong understanding of MEP
coordination and how electrical systems integrate with mechanical
and plumbing components. Proficient in reading blueprints, one-line
diagrams, and construction schedules. Ability to manage multiple
crews and prioritize tasks under tight deadlines. Working knowledge
of jobsite safety practices and OSHA standards. Interested in
